How to Monetize Your Mobile App: Models and Strategies

Oct 4, 2024

Mobile apps have become a central part of digital strategy, and monetizing an app effectively can generate substantial revenue. However, finding the right model for your app type, audience, and market can be challenging. This guide covers popular app monetization models, the strategies that maximize revenue, and tips for choosing the best fit for your app.

1. In-App Advertising

In-app advertising is one of the most popular ways to monetize apps, especially those offered for free. It involves displaying ads within the app, allowing developers to earn revenue from impressions, clicks, or conversions.

Types of In-App Ads:

  • Banner Ads: Simple, static or animated ads typically shown at the top or bottom of the screen.

  • Interstitial Ads: Full-screen ads that appear at natural transition points, such as between levels in a game.

  • Rewarded Video Ads: Users opt to watch an ad in exchange for an in-app reward (extra lives, bonus points).

  • Native Ads: Ads designed to blend seamlessly with the app’s content, improving user experience.

Best Practices for In-App Advertising:

  • Ensure ads don’t disrupt user experience. Keep banner ads unobtrusive and avoid frequent interstitials.

  • Use rewarded ads in gaming apps to improve user engagement.

  • Optimize ad placement to balance user retention and revenue.

2. Freemium Model

The freemium model allows users to download the app for free but charges for premium features or content. This strategy attracts a broad user base, and then aims to convert free users into paying ones by offering additional functionality, enhanced experiences, or ad-free options.

Popular Freemium Features:

  • Advanced Tools: Some features are gated and require a premium version.

  • Ad-Free Experience: Allow users to pay a small fee to remove ads.

  • Exclusive Content: For media or educational apps, access to exclusive articles, tutorials, or lessons can be locked behind a paywall.

Freemium Model Tips:

  • Offer genuinely valuable features to encourage upgrades.

  • Provide a seamless onboarding experience to showcase premium features.

  • Allow users to experience a free trial of premium features to increase conversions.

3. In-App Purchases (IAPs)

In-app purchases involve users paying for consumable or non-consumable digital goods. Common in gaming and utility apps, IAPs allow users to buy virtual currency, premium content, or upgrades.

Types of In-App Purchases:

  • Consumables: Items that users can buy, use, and repurchase, such as extra lives, virtual currency, or boosts.

  • Non-Consumables: One-time purchases, like removing ads or unlocking a new feature.

  • Subscriptions (Recurring Purchases): Users pay regularly for access to content or features, which can help generate a steady revenue stream.

Best Practices for IAPs:

• Make purchases easy and straightforward.
• Offer in-app currencies to make the experience smooth.
• Don’t make the app overly dependent on purchases to remain usable, as this can frustrate users.

4. Subscription Model

Subscription models have gained popularity, especially for content, productivity, and wellness apps. This approach allows developers to charge users on a recurring basis, often monthly or annually, for continued access to premium features or content.

Subscription Types:

  • Freemium Subscription: Users access basic features for free but pay for premium content or functionality.

  • Paid Subscription: Users pay from the outset to access any app content, common in streaming, fitness, and learning apps.

Subscription Tips:

  • Offer a free trial to attract new users.

  • Provide substantial value in the premium content or features.

  • Use tiered pricing (e.g., Basic, Premium, Family) to attract different user segments.

5. Paid App Model

A straightforward model where users pay a one-time fee to download the app. This model has lost traction with the rise of free apps and ad-supported models, but it can still work for highly specialized apps with unique features.

Tips for Paid Apps:

  • Offer a demo or trial version to let users test before committing.

  • Ensure the app provides substantial value and unique features.

  • Set a competitive price point aligned with the app’s functionality.

6. Sponsorship and Partnerships

For certain apps, sponsorships or partnerships can be a great way to generate revenue. Sponsorship usually involves a brand paying for visibility within the app or through in-app promotions. This model works well for apps with niche audiences or those built around a specific purpose, such as fitness, wellness, or travel.

How Sponsorships Work:

  • Brand Placement: Sponsors get branded content or custom themes within the app.

  • Content Partnerships: Collaborate with brands to produce sponsored content relevant to your users.

  • Special Events: Create limited-time events or challenges sponsored by brands, commonly used in fitness or gaming apps.

Best Practices:

  • Partner with brands that align with your user base for a seamless experience.

  • Avoid overwhelming users with excessive branding.

  • Use data to demonstrate value to potential sponsors (e.g., user demographics, engagement rates).

7. Crowdfunding and Donations

For niche or socially-driven apps, crowdfunding and donation models are viable alternatives. This method is commonly used by educational, community-focused, or non-profit apps where users believe in the cause and are willing to contribute.

Crowdfunding Platforms:

  • Kickstarter and GoFundMe: Useful for pre-launch funding, allowing developers to gauge interest.

  • In-App Donations: Direct donation features within the app for ongoing support.

Best Practices:

  • Be transparent about how donations will improve the app.

  • Keep donation options unobtrusive but accessible.

  • Offer incentives for donations, like exclusive content or special recognition.

Choosing the Right Monetization Model for Your App

The ideal monetization model depends on your app’s purpose, target audience, and market positioning. For example:

  • Gaming Apps often excel with in-app purchases and ads.

  • Productivity Apps might benefit from a freemium or subscription model.

  • Educational Apps can leverage subscriptions or sponsorships for recurring revenue.

  • User Preferences: Test different approaches to see what resonates.

  • Competitive Analysis: Research competitors to see which models perform well in your app category.

  • User Experience: Prioritize user experience to avoid losing users to overly intrusive monetization efforts.

Conclusion

Selecting the right monetization strategy is a critical step in mobile app development. It impacts not only your revenue potential but also user experience and retention. By aligning your monetization model with user expectations and testing to refine your approach, you can create a sustainable revenue stream that supports long-term growth. Whether you choose in-app ads, subscriptions, or a freemium approach, each model offers unique benefits and requires careful planning for optimal success.

With the right approach, your app can generate revenue while delivering a valuable, enjoyable experience for your users.

Frequently Asked Questions

1. What are the most common ways to monetize a mobile app?

Popular app monetization methods include in-app purchases, advertising, subscription models, freemium options, and pay-per-download. Each method has its advantages, and choosing the right one depends on your app type, audience, and revenue goals.

2. How does in-app advertising work for app monetization?

In-app advertising allows you to display ads within your app, earning revenue each time a user views or interacts with them. Common ad types include banner ads, interstitial ads, video ads, and native ads. Ad revenue depends on the ad format, placement, and user engagement rates.

3. What is the freemium model, and why is it effective for app monetization?

The freemium model offers a free version of the app with limited features, encouraging users to pay for premium content or features. It allows users to try the app before committing to a purchase, increasing conversion rates for premium upgrades.

4. Can I monetize my app with a pay-per-download model?

Yes, the pay-per-download model charges users an upfront fee to download the app. This method is less common today, as users often expect free apps. However, it works well for apps with unique features or niche audiences who are willing to pay for a high-quality experience.

5. How can offering sponsorships help monetize my app?

Sponsorships involve partnering with brands to promote their products or services within your app. This method can be a good fit for niche apps with a loyal user base. Sponsors may pay for brand exposure, special promotions, or co-branded content.

6. What is affiliate marketing in mobile apps, and how can it generate revenue?

Affiliate marketing involves promoting third-party products or services within your app, earning a commission for each successful referral or sale. For example, a fitness app might recommend sports equipment and earn a commission on each sale generated through the app.

7. What factors should I consider when choosing a monetization strategy for my app?

Consider your app’s target audience, user experience, and core value. Some models, like ads, may disrupt the user experience, while others, like subscriptions, require ongoing content updates. It’s essential to balance revenue generation with user satisfaction to maintain long-term success.

8. How can I use data analytics to improve my app monetization strategy?

Data analytics can provide insights into user behavior, engagement, and purchase patterns. By analyzing this data, you can identify high-value users, optimize ad placements, and improve in-app purchase options, enhancing your overall monetization strategy.

9. What are rewarded video ads, and how can they help monetize my app?

Rewarded video ads offer users incentives, such as in-game currency or extra features, for watching an ad. This ad format is user-friendly and effective for increasing engagement, as users are more likely to watch ads voluntarily for rewards, boosting ad revenue.

10. What are the best monetization strategies for gaming apps?

Gaming apps often succeed with in-app purchases (e.g., virtual goods), rewarded video ads, and freemium models. Gamification features, such as daily rewards, can enhance engagement, while in-app purchases and ads provide a balanced approach to revenue generation.

11. What are the advantages of using a hybrid monetization strategy?

A hybrid monetization strategy combines multiple methods, such as ads, in-app purchases, and subscriptions. This approach diversifies revenue streams and maximizes earning potential by offering different options that appeal to various user preferences.

12. What is A/B testing, and how can it optimize my app monetization?

A/B testing allows you to test different monetization strategies, such as ad placements or subscription pricing, with segmented user groups. By analyzing which version performs better, you can make data-driven decisions to optimize revenue without compromising user experience.